Description

This application is produced by MathCancer Lab to explain "Motility" in PhysiCell [1]. User can specify basic simulation and motility parameters. To run the simulation with specified parameters, one should click the green "Run" button at the bottom of the page. In the Cell Plot section, sliding frame allows to visualize cell behavior in time. There is only one substrate in this simulation which is "tracer" that is secreted by cells to the environment.
